L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

VI API - The solution to all problems

I really dislike this trend of sensationalism that has taken over nearly all internet communication these days. Can't take anything seriously any more.

~ Self-professed LabVIEW wizard ~
Helping pave the path to long-term living and thriving in space.
Message 11 of 15
(292 Views)

I didn't have a specific technique in mind—nor could I if I wanted to—when creating this post, but the problems I initially mentioned are real. The IDE doesn't work well for working with classes. Dynamic tooling for frameworks is also an issue, impacting collaboration and versioning.

 

I also don't think XML exports are a solution, as this hasn't worked well for Qt's designer either. However, a coded Qt GUI can be effectively versioned.

 

I never used scripting, but it doesn't look like something that benefits from being done graphically. Scripting seems like something that could have a C or .NET interface without losing anything.

 

Actor Framework
0 Kudos
Message 12 of 15
(266 Views)

pylabview may be the closest you can get. Somewhere in this presentation it's stated NI uses this tool and is unlikely to let it be abandoned (but far short of describing it as actually supported).

Message 13 of 15
(260 Views)

@avogadro5 wrote:

pylabview may be the closest you can get. Somewhere in this presentation it's stated NI uses this tool and is unlikely to let it be abandoned (but far short of describing it as actually supported).


It's at 27:00 to about 28:00, Interesting statement. But really the whole presentation is definitely worth watching! Also touches the LVAddon ini file settings, so a minor start into LVAddons.

Rolf Kalbermatter
My Blog
0 Kudos
Message 14 of 15
(186 Views)

And here I thought all problems were caused by rampant use of social media.  But everyone on Twitter said that was wrong so...  🤔

LabVIEW Pro Dev & Measurement Studio Pro (VS Pro) 2019
Message 15 of 15
(172 Views)